3,4-Epoxycyclohexylmethyl 3,4-epoxycyclohexanecarboxylate is an industrial chemical used as a reactive diluent for epoxy resins. It also serves as a stabilizer for organophosphorus insecticides, though it has no known commercial production in the United States.

The international HS code for 3,4-Epoxycyclohexylmethyl 3,4-epoxycyclohexanecarboxylate (CAS 2386-87-0) is 2918.99.
